Cultivation method of fragrant woodThe fragrant wood is a shrub or small tree of the Anacardiaceae family. It can generally be propagated by sowing and cuttings. It likes sunshine and is slightly shade-tolerant. The growing environment requires a deep soil layer and can withstand low temperatures of -10°C. It likes soil with sufficient sunlight and is not prone to waterlogging. Fragrant wood likes a warm growing environment, so it is usually better to keep it indoors, but be careful that the temperature cannot exceed 30℃. It should be kept above 10℃ in winter. Too low temperature will frostbite the plant. Watering methodWhen caring for the fragrant wood, do not water it too frequently. About once every 3-5 days is enough. Water it thoroughly when watering. Do not water too much and do not let water accumulate at the bottom of the pot, otherwise its roots will rot. Fertilization methodTry to apply as little fertilizer as possible to the fragrant wood. If too much fertilizer is applied, it will cause fertilizer damage and burn the root system. During the growing season, you can apply more fertilizer to ensure the growth of the plant. Pruning methodsIf the fragrant wood grows too high or too densely, it can be pruned appropriately to promote the sprouting of new branches. For potted plants maintained at home, 50 to 70 cm with the pot is the most suitable height. Things to note when growing fragrant woodDo not place the fragrant wood next to items that radiate and dissipate heat, such as televisions and computers. When growing it, pay attention to regular pruning, adjust the growth direction, do not let it grow in one direction, and give it sufficient light every day, but be careful not to expose it to direct sunlight to avoid sunburn. |
